Handover note — Crumbwheel order cutoffs.

Welcome aboard. The bakery cutoff rule in Crumbwheel closes same-day orders at 14:00 local to each storefront, not UTC — this has bitten us twice. Holiday overrides live in the calendar service and take precedence silently, so always check there first when a cutoff looks wrong. To unlock the calendar service's admin console after a restart, enter the recovery passphrase below.

vault phrase of bagap-bahaf = silion-pelox-sorox-casdor-quenwyn-fraax-eliox-praael-kelion-quenvan-kasox-rusael-norius-belvan

### Deploy Step 4 — Enable dark mode in the Opsreach admin dashboard

Dark mode assets are served from the theming service, which validates requests before returning compiled stylesheets. Reviewers should confirm the env file is readable only by the deploy user. The theming service's signing credential must be set on the next line.

sealed setting: ARCHIVE_KEY3=8d0

**Mgmt Meeting Minutes — Retiring the Brightline Range**

Quick recap for sales leads at Fenholt Supplies: we agreed to retire the Brightline fixture range by year-end. Remaining stock moves to clearance pricing next month, and accounts on standing orders get migrated to the Lumetta range. Trade-in incentives were approved in principle. The confidential note on next steps sits just below.

board note of bajof-bajeg: The pricing group signed off on a budget of $13.4 million for Project Sildor. The renewal with Lamixek Holdings closes at $48.9 million a year, 49 percent above the last contract.

**Release checklist — SDK parity verification (Lanternfall 3.2)**

Before you sign off, confirm that the Quillet JavaScript SDK and the Quillet Swift SDK expose identical surface areas for the new batching API. That means matching method names, matching default retry counts (three, not five — the Swift side drifted last cycle), and matching error enum cases. Run the parity script in the tools directory and attach its output to the ticket. Paste the build token it prints right here.

pipeline stamp: htk6_c0ef30